6'3" and infant seats
I'm considering a smaller vehicle than my RX for commuting purposes. Anyone 6'3+ own an IS and able to fit two rear facing car seats in the back?
#2
Racer
iTrader: (2)
I don't have kids, but I did try this with my niece and nephew once. Rear facing, unfortunately, will make whoever is in the front seats have very little leg room (which sucked as I'm 6'0", and you're 6'3" so it'll be worse for you). Had to kill that idea before I pulled out of the driveway.
These just really aren't the type of cars to be ferrying more than 2 people around in unfortunately. Your better choice would be looking at an ES or a GS for the rear space if you want to stick with Lexus. Alternatively, a Camry or an Avalon would also be fine choices if you'd at least like to stay under the Toyota umbrella.

Not a chance. I used a rear facing seat in my IS and there was no way it could go behind me at 6'2". Even with it behind the passenger seat, the wife at 5'5" was crammed uncomfortably close to the dash.

I have two twins that are 1 years old now and the rear facing seats won't fit behind me at 6 ft. I ended up getting a new car for the family and use the IS when i'm alone.
